Train
Walk to the nearest train station, 'Venezia Santa Lucia', from your location in Venice. Once at the station, purchase a ticket to 'Padova' (Padua). The train ride typically lasts around 30 minutes. Upon arriving at 'Padova', exit the train station and look for the local bus station or taxi services. You can catch a bus that goes directly to Torreglia. Confirm that the bus stops at 'Via Roccolo'.
